The College of Food, Agricultural, and Environmental Sciences is seeking a strategic and ethical leader to champion a culture of integrity, accountability, and compliance across the organization. This position serves as a central resource for ethical decision-making, policy development, and risk mitigation.
This position will have responsibilities across the entire CFAES enterprise and mission, including locations in Columbus, Wooster and statewide.
Key responsibilities include promoting ethical behavior through codes of conduct and training, ensuring compliance with federal, state, and institutional regulations, and proactively identifying and addressing legal, financial, and reputational risks. The role oversees internal investigations, collaborates with HR and legal teams, and ensures fair and confidential resolution processes. It also leads efforts in policy development and review, provides education and capacity-building initiatives, and maintains transparent communication with internal stakeholders. Additionally, the position engages with external partners, including accrediting bodies, government agencies, donors, and alumni to reinforce the college's commitment to ethics and institutional integrity. This is a high-impact role requiring excellent judgment, strategic thinking, and the ability to build trust across various audiences.
Minimum qualifications: Bachelor's degree or equivalent experience. 6 years of relevant experience required. 8-12 years of relevant experience preferred.
This position reports directly to the Associate Dean and Director for College of Food, Agricultural and Environmental Sciences, Wooster Campus and has a dotted-line reporting relationship to the Vice President for Agricultural Administration and Dean of the College of Food, Agricultural, and Environmental Sciences.
